Post by SuperRickyFuller on Aug 27, 2014 19:20:45 GMT
Unless the Premier League pay Sky to do the camera work.
From what I understand, the Premier League sells the rights to other stations, like Canel in France and Al-Mohammed in Saudi Arabia (I might've made that broadcaster up). The streams are then taken from those. For some reason, those rights aren't sold to any broadcaster in this country, therefore we have to rely on streams.
I think the Football League own the League Cup broadcasting rights and obviously don't sell the live rights to them to any other country, hence no streams. Obviously you get to see replays of the goals but that's where the rights must be negotiated differently.
|
|
|
Post by Shiny Nosehair on Aug 27, 2014 19:21:06 GMT
Yup, cameras belong to the broadcaster chosen, remainder take feed from them
So, most weekends, four games move for live coverage and the broadcaster transmitting the game puts in all the cameras. The other broadcasters then take a feed of that coverage. Mondays excepted, we send commentators for MOTD or MOTD2 to commentate to their pictures. (Just in case anyone still wants to claim that we don't send commentators to games, can I insert a pre-emptive "Oh yes we do!" in here?) So, for those games, we're entirely reliant on another company's match directors and technicians for our pictures. Fortunately, the coverage tends to be uniformly good these days
